Understanding Adjustment of Status and Its Complexities
Adjustment of Status is the process by which an individual converts their immigration standing from a temporary or undocumented standing to that of a lawful permanent resident. It seems like a single action, but it actually involves multiple applications, necessary records, medical examinations, background checks, and often an in-person appointment. Each of these phases comes with its own set of rules, and omitting even a minor detail can bring about processing slowdowns or flat-out refusals.

How an Attorney Helps You Avoid Costly Mistakes
One of the primary reasons to hire an attorney is the sheer amount of paperwork that comes with the process. Form I-485, the primary form for Adjustment of Status, is merely the starting point. Depending on your specific situation, you may additionally be required to complete and submit Form I-130, Form I-864, employment authorization documents, and travel permits — all of which come with precise directions and documentary demands. An qualified attorney knows just which applications apply to your distinct situation and how to prepare them without errors the first time.
Missteps on immigration documents are not insignificant problems. A erroneous response, a omitted signature, or an incomplete portion can bring about a Request for Evidence from USCIS, which contributes significant delays to your schedule. In more serious situations, contradictions or inaccuracies might arouse suspicion that result in extra scrutiny or even suspicion of fraudulent activity. An immigration counsel scrutinizes every element before submittal, substantially diminishing the possibility of these complications.
More than paperwork, attorneys understand the legal nuances that most applicants just aren’t familiar with. For example, particular prior immigration offenses, criminal records, or prior deportation orders can create bars to eligibility that aren’t necessarily obvious. A well-versed lawyer can evaluate your background candidly and aid you determine whether a waiver is obtainable or if an alternative course of action would more effectively advance your interests.

Who is eligible to apply for Adjustment of Status in Tudor Village, NY?
Eligibility for Adjustment of Status ordinarily necessitates that the individual has an accepted immigrant request, has an currently obtainable immigrant visa allocation, was lawfully entered or paroled into the United States, and is not subject to any barriers to adjustment. What documents are required for an Adjustment of Status application?
Applicants typically are required to furnish Form I-485, a duplicate of their certificate of birth, passport-style photographs, documentation of lawful admission into the United States, an authorized immigration visa petition, medical examination findings from a certified civil surgeon, financial sponsorship records such as Form I-864 Affidavit of Support, and any additional documentation related to their situation. Can I work in the United States while my Adjustment of Status application is pending?
Applicants who have applied for Adjustment of Status may apply for an Employment Authorization Document (EAD) utilizing Form I-765, which affords them the lawful ability to maintain employment in the United States while their case is awaiting adjudication. What happens if my Adjustment of Status application is denied?
If an Adjustment of Status petition is denied, the applicant will be sent a notification detailing the grounds for the denial. Depending on the situation, there may be avenues available such as filing a motion to reopen or reconsider, challenging the ruling, or pursuing other immigration relief.
